Private tracker torrents work fine, but e.g. the Ubuntu torrent gets stuck at "Downloading 0.00%" with the following errors:
Deluge is running in a container on Kubernetes, and I've verified with tcpdump that both TCP and UDP traffic on port 6881 can reach it, and that the container has Internet access. I've also verified that the torrent can be downloaded with another client from the host.
I've observed that Deluge doesn't listen on TCP Port 6881, despite claiming so in the logs. Only UDP. Normal?
